Discovering that your WordPress website has been hacked can be stressful. One day your site works perfectly, and the next day visitors are redirected to spam pages, strange ads appear on your homepage, or Google warns users that your website may be dangerous.
A hacked website can damage your reputation, reduce search rankings, expose customer information, and even lead to financial losses if left unresolved.
The good news is that a hacked WordPress website can usually be recovered if you act quickly and follow the right steps.
In this guide, you’ll learn how to recover a hacked WordPress website safely, rem malware, secure your files, and prevent future attacks.
For businesses and website owners who need professional WordPress security and recovery support, HarmonWeb provides reliable website maintenance, malware clean-up, and security monitoring services.
Signs Your WordPress Website Has Been Hacked
Sometimes the signs are obvious. Other times, malware can stay hidden for weeks before website owners notice anything unusual.
Common signs of a hacked WordPress website include:
- Sudden website crashes
- Unexpected redirects
- Strange popups or spam ads
- New admin accounts you did not create
- Slow website performance
- Google security warnings
- Missing website files
- Unusual traffic spikes
- Visitors reporting suspicious behavior
Hackers often inject malicious code quietly in the background, making early detection extremely important.
Why WordPress Websites Get Hacked
WordPress itself is secure, but vulnerabilities often come from poor website management.
The most common causes include:
- Outdated plugins
- Weak passwords.
- Insecure hosting
- Nulled or pirated themes
- Outdated WordPress versions
- Poor website security practices
A single vulnerable plugin can give hackers access to your entire website.
This is why proactive security monitoring from providers like HarmonWeb is important for businesses that rely heavily on website uptime and customer trust.
How to Recover a Hacked WordPress Website
If your website has been compromised, avoid panicking. Follow these steps carefully to recover your website safely.
1. Put Your Website in Maintenance Mode
The first thing you should do is limit public access to the hacked website.
This helps:
- Protect visitors
- Prevent further damage
- Stop malware from spreading
You can temporarily:
- Enable maintenance mode
- Disable the website
- Use a security plugin to block suspicious activity
If your hosting provider offers malware quarantine tools, activate them immediately.
2. Change All Passwords Immediately
Hackers often gain access through weak passwords.
Immediately change:
- WordPress admin passwords
- Hosting account passwords
- FTP passwords
- Database passwords
- Email account passwords
Use strong passwords with:
- Uppercase letters
- Lowercase letters
- Numbers
- Symbols
Avoid reusing old passwords.
3. Scan Your Website for Malware
A malware scan helps identify infected files and suspicious code.
Common areas hackers target include:
- WordPress core files
- Plugin folders
- Theme files
- The database
Security plugins can help detect threats, but advanced infections may require professional clean-up services.
Businesses that want thorough malware removal often use expert WordPress security support from Harmonweb to identify hidden vulnerabilities and clean infected files safely.
4. Remove Suspicious Users and Files
Hackers sometimes create hidden administrator accounts to maintain access to the website.
Check your WordPress dashboard carefully and remove:
- Unknown admin users
- Suspicious plugins
- Unauthorized themes
- Unfamiliar files
You should also inspect important folders such as:
- wp-content
- uploads
- wp-admin
Look for unusual file names or recently modified files you do not recognize.
5. Restore a Clean Backup
If you have a recent backup created before the hack occured, restoring it may be the fastest recovery option.
A clean backup can:
- Remove malware quickly
- Restore damaged files
- Reduce downtime
However, make sure the backup itself is not infected before restoring it.
This is why regular website backups are extremely important for WordPress websites.
6. Reinstall WordPress Core Files
Hackers sometimes modify important WordPress files.
To replace infected core files:
- Download a fresh copy of WordPress
Replace:
- wp-admin
- wp-includes
Do not replace:
- wp-content
- wp-config.php
This refreshes the WordPress system files without deleting your website content.
7. Update Plugins, Themes, and WordPress
Outdated software is one of the biggest causes of WordPress hacks.
After cleaning your website:
- Update WordPress
- Update plugins
- Update themes
- Delete unused plugins
Only install plugins and themes from trusted sources.
Avoid pirated or nulled themes completely because they often contain hidden malware.
8. Secure Your Website Properly
Recovering the website is only part of the solution. You also need to prevent future attacks.
Important security measures include:
- Enabling two-factor authentication
- Limiting login attempts
- Installing a firewall
- Scanning for malware regularly
- Using secure hosting
- Creating automatic backups
Professional website maintenance services from HarmonWeb can help website owners monitor vulnerabilities, strengthen security, and reduce the risk of future attacks.
How to Prevent Your WordPress Website From Getting Hacked Again
Once your website is clean, prevention becomes the priority.
Here are practical ways to improve long-term WordPress security.
1. Use Reliable Hosting
Weak hosting environments make websites easier to attack.
A reliable hosting provider offers:
- Stronger server security
- Malware protection
- Automatic backups
- Better uptime monitoring
- Cheap hosting may save money initially but oftenincreases security risks later.
2. Avoid Too Many Plugins
Installing too many plugins increases vulnerability risks.
Only use plugins that:
- Are actively maintained
- Have positive reviews
- Come from trusted developers
Delete plugins you no longer need.
3. Keep Regular Backups
Backups are your safety net during security emergencies.
If your website gets hacked again, a recent backup can save hours of recovery work.
Automated daily or weekly backups are strongly recommended.
4. Monitor Website Activity
Suspicious activity often appears before a major attack happens.
Monitor:
- Failed login attempts
- Unusual traffic spikes
- Unknown file changes
- Strange redirects
Early detection makes recovery much easier.
Businesses that want proactive website monitoring often rely on Harmonweb for ongoing WordPress maintenance and security management.
Final Thoughts
A hacked WordPress website can feel overwhelming, but most websites can be recovered successfully with the right approach.
The most important steps include:
- Changing passwords
- Scanning for malware
- Removing suspicious files
- Restoring clean backups
- Updating outdated software
- Improving website security
Acting quickly can reduce downtime, protect your visitors, and prevent further damage to your brand.
For businesses, bloggers, and online stores that need dependable WordPress security support, malware clean-up, and website maintenance, HarmonWeb offers practical solutions designed to keep WordPress websites secure, stable, and protected from future attacks.


